More often than not when we discuss harassment at work the topic quickly shifts to sexual harassment. There's no doubt that it is an ethical issue in business that should be taken very, very seriously - and if you're not sure why then you need to read about the#MeToo Movement. While we shouldn't forget that there are many forms of harassment in the workplace, sexual harassment is one that deserves to be addressed on its own.

According to the U.S. Equal Employment Opportunity Commission (EEOC), in 2018 alone there were more than7,600allegations of sexual harassment made. Not only that but the resulting monetary benefits for those plaintiffs were in excess of $56.6 million - an indication of the validity of those claims.

When we take an even closer look at this ethical issue, we find that54%of women report having experienced unwanted sexual advances in the workplace and 23% said that the instance of sexual harassment actually involved a superior.

These numbers paint a troubling reality and present real challenges to creating a workplace environment where people feel secure and comfortable.
